Transport Network Design Group Leader

Bosch
Summary
Join Robert Bosch Kft. in Budapest as a Transport Network Design Team Lead. Lead a team of experts in designing the European transport network, encompassing approximately 100 plants. Define, prioritize, and implement optimization projects across various transport solutions. Collaborate with internal customers (plants & divisions) and act as an interface between management and plants. Coach and develop the network design team, reviewing process maturity levels in other regions. This role requires supply chain management expertise, network optimization experience, and strong analytical and communication skills. Responsibilities
- Leading the Transport Network Design team
- Designing the European transport network containing the transport volume of ~100 plants
- Defining, prioritizing and implementing optimization projects within different transport solutions
- Providing all relevant input parameters to the team for tendering
- Regular internal customer (plants & divisions) communication and collaboration
- Coaching and developing of the network design team
- Acting as an interface between the management, plants and divisions
- Reviewing the process maturity level of other network design teams in other regions of Bosch and providing / exchanging know-how
